Building legitimacy by criticising the pharmaceutical industry: a qualitative study among prescribers and local opinion leaders
PRINCIPLES: The literature has described opinion leaders not only as marketing tools of the pharmaceutical industry, but also as educators promoting good clinical practice. This qualitative study addresses the distinction between the opinion-leader-as-marketing-tool and the opinion-leader-as-educa...
